Please use this identifier to cite or link to this item: https://ric.cps.sp.gov.br/handle/123456789/35434
Title: Integração de banco de dados relacionais em arquiteturas de microsserviços: desafios e soluções
Other Titles: Relational database integration in microservices architectures: challenges and solutions
Authors: LISBOA, Flavio Fernandes
Advisor: SHAMMAS, Gabriel Issa Jabra
type of document: Monografia
Keywords: Banco de dados relacionais;Integração;Sistema produto-serviço;Arquitetura
Issue Date: 25-Jun-2025
Publisher: 002
Citation: LISBOA, Flavio Fernandes. Integração de banco de dados relacionais em arquiteturas de microsserviços: desafios e soluções, 2025. Trabalho de conclusão de curso (Curso Superior de Tecnologia em Análise e Desenvolvimento de Sistemas) – Faculdade de Tecnologia de São Paulo, São Paulo, 2025.
Abstract: Este Trabalho de Conclusão de Curso tem como objetivo analisar os desafios enfrentados na integração de bancos de dados relacionais em arquiteturas baseadas em microsserviços. A adoção dessa arquitetura oferece benefícios como escalabilidade e modularidade, mas também impõe barreiras significativas no que diz respeito à consistência de dados, transações distribuídas e manutenção da integridade referencial. Foram exploradas soluções como o uso de padrões Sagas, CQRS e Change Data Capture (CDC), além da mensageria como forma de promover desacoplamento entre serviços. Com base em um estudo de caso fictício, a viabilidade técnica da proposta foi verificada nos testes realizados, indicando que, embora complexa, a integração pode ser alcançada com planejamento e adoção de boas práticas.
This undergraduate thesis aims to analyze the challenges involved in integrating relational databases within microservices-based architectures. While adopting this architectural style provides benefits such as scalability and modularity, it also imposes significant barriers regarding data consistency, distributed transactions, and referential integrity maintenance. Solutions such as the use of Sagas, CQRS, and Change Data Capture (CDC) patterns were explored, along with messaging as a way to promote decoupling between services. Based on a fictional case study, the technical feasibility of the proposed approach was verified through tests, indicating that although complex, integration can be achieved through careful planning and the adoption of best practices.
URI: https://ric.cps.sp.gov.br/handle/123456789/35434
Appears in Collections:Trabalhos de conclusão de curso

Files in This Item:
File Description SizeFormat 
analiseedesenvolvimentodesistemas_2025_1_flaviofernandeslisboa_integraçãodebancosdedadosrelacionais.pdf
  Restricted Access
584.1 kBAdobe PDFView/Open Request a copy


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.